Software Development in Markham

Find local Markham Software Development
PDF-File.com
Markham, Central Scotland, L3R 9M6
1.888.882.9495

Reference Number: 10283
Software Development near me Software Development Markham

Markham Software Development

Find Software Development Near Me in our Software Development Directory